什么是excel索引
作者:百问excel教程网
|
177人看过
发布时间:2025-12-27 10:20:34
标签:
什么是Excel索引?深度解析与实用指南在Excel中,索引是一个非常基础且重要的功能,它主要用来快速定位和引用数据表中的特定位置。索引不仅能够帮助用户找到特定的数据,还能够通过不同的参数实现灵活的数据操作。本文将从定义、基本原理、使
什么是Excel索引?深度解析与实用指南
在Excel中,索引是一个非常基础且重要的功能,它主要用来快速定位和引用数据表中的特定位置。索引不仅能够帮助用户找到特定的数据,还能够通过不同的参数实现灵活的数据操作。本文将从定义、基本原理、使用方法、高级应用、常见误区以及实际案例等多个方面,全面解析Excel索引的使用技巧和注意事项。
一、什么是Excel索引?
Excel索引指的是在数据表中,通过一个或多个参数,来确定某个位置的数据。例如,在一个包含多列数据的表格中,如果我们想找到第3行第2列的数据,就可以使用索引功能来实现这个目标。索引是Excel中用于定位数据位置的核心工具之一,它使用户能够高效地进行数据查找和操作。
索引的实现方式多种多样,常见的有使用“INDEX”函数、结合“MATCH”函数使用、“ROW”函数、“COLUMN”函数等。这些函数在Excel中可以组合使用,以实现更复杂的查询和操作。
二、索引的基本原理
索引的核心在于“位置”和“引用”。Excel中的索引功能本质上是一种通过参数定位数据位置的机制。在Excel中,索引可以用于以下几种情况:
1. 定位数据:在数据表中,用户可以通过索引功能快速找到特定行或列的数据。
2. 数据引用:通过索引,用户可以从一个数据范围中引用特定位置的数据,比如引用第3行第2列的数据。
3. 数据操作:索引可以与其它函数结合使用,实现数据的筛选、排序、计算等操作。
索引的实现方式通常基于“行号”和“列号”,用户可以通过输入行号和列号来定位数据的位置。例如,使用“INDEX(范围, 行号, 列号)”函数,可以引用特定位置的数据。
三、索引的基本使用方法
在Excel中,索引功能主要通过“INDEX”函数来实现。其基本语法如下:
INDEX(范围, 行号, 列号)
- 范围:要引用的数据区域,例如A1:C10。
- 行号:要引用的行号,例如3。
- 列号:要引用的列号,例如2。
示例:
假设我们有一个数据表,数据范围是A1:C10,内容如下:
| A | B | C |
|--|--|--|
| 1 | 10 | 100 |
| 2 | 20 | 200 |
| 3 | 30 | 300 |
如果我们想查找第3行第2列的数据,可以使用以下公式:
=INDEX(A1:C10, 3, 2)
这个公式将返回“30”。
四、索引的高级应用
索引不仅仅可以用于简单定位数据,还可以通过与其他函数的结合,实现更复杂的操作。以下是几种常见的高级应用:
1. 结合“MATCH”函数使用
“MATCH”函数用于查找某个值在数据范围中的位置,而“INDEX”函数则用于引用该位置的数据。它们的组合可以实现数据查找和引用。
示例:
假设我们有一个数据表,其中A列是产品名称,B列是价格,我们想查找“笔记本电脑”的价格,可以使用以下公式:
=INDEX(B1:B10, MATCH("笔记本电脑", A1:A10, 0))
这个公式首先使用“MATCH”函数查找“笔记本电脑”在A列中的位置,然后使用“INDEX”函数引用该位置对应的价格。
2. 结合“ROW”函数使用
“ROW”函数用于返回当前单元格的行号,可以用于动态定位数据位置。
示例:
如果我们要引用当前工作表中第3行的数据,可以使用以下公式:
=INDEX(A1:A10, ROW(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1。
3. 结合“COLUMN”函数使用
“COLUMN”函数用于返回当前单元格的列号,可以用于动态定位数据位置。
示例:
如果我们要引用当前工作表中第2列的数据,可以使用以下公式:
=INDEX(A1:C10, ROW(1), COLUMN(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1,COLUMN(1)返回的是1。
五、索引的常见误区与注意事项
在使用索引功能时,用户可能会遇到一些常见的误区和问题,以下是几个需要注意的事项:
1. 索引的参数必须是整数
在Excel中,索引函数的参数必须是整数,不能是文本或小数。例如,使用“INDEX(A1:C10, 3.5)”是无效的。
2. 索引不能用于非连续数据
索引功能只能用于连续的数据范围,不能用于非连续的单元格。例如,如果数据范围是A1:A10和C1:C10,不能直接使用“INDEX”函数引用其中的数据。
3. 索引的数值范围需要合理
索引的行号和列号必须在数据范围的合法范围内。如果超出范围,Excel会返回错误值。
4. 索引的使用需要结合其他函数
索引功能通常需要与其他函数配合使用,才能实现更复杂的操作。例如,使用“INDEX”和“MATCH”组合可以实现数据查找。
六、索引的实际应用案例
索引在实际工作中有着广泛的应用,以下是几个实际案例:
案例1:数据表查询
假设我们有一个销售数据表,包含产品名称、销售数量和销售额。我们想查找某个产品的销售额,可以使用以下公式:
=INDEX(B2:B10, MATCH(C2, A2:A10, 0))
这个公式会找到“笔记本电脑”在A列中的位置,然后返回对应的产品销售额。
案例2:动态数据引用
在Excel中,我们经常需要引用当前工作表中的特定数据。例如,如果我们有一个数据表,数据范围是A1:C10,我们想引用第1行第3列的数据,可以使用:
=INDEX(A1:C10, 1, 3)
这个公式将返回A1:C10中的第1行第3列的数据。
案例3:动态行号引用
如果我们想引用当前工作表中第3行的数据,可以使用以下公式:
=INDEX(A1:A10, ROW(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1。
七、索引的未来发展与趋势
随着Excel的不断升级,索引功能也在不断完善和优化。未来,Excel可能会引入更多智能化的索引功能,比如基于数据类型、条件筛选、动态范围等的索引,使得用户可以更方便地进行数据操作。
此外,随着人工智能和机器学习技术的发展,Excel可能逐步引入智能索引功能,帮助用户更快地找到所需数据。
八、总结
Excel索引是一种非常实用的功能,它帮助用户快速定位和引用数据,并且可以通过与其他函数的结合实现更复杂的操作。在实际工作中,索引功能可以极大地提高数据处理的效率和准确性。用户在使用索引时,需要注意参数的正确性、范围的合法性和与其他函数的配合使用。
掌握Excel索引功能,不仅能够提升工作效率,还能帮助用户更好地理解和处理数据。希望本文能够为用户提供有价值的参考和帮助。
在Excel中,索引是一个非常基础且重要的功能,它主要用来快速定位和引用数据表中的特定位置。索引不仅能够帮助用户找到特定的数据,还能够通过不同的参数实现灵活的数据操作。本文将从定义、基本原理、使用方法、高级应用、常见误区以及实际案例等多个方面,全面解析Excel索引的使用技巧和注意事项。
一、什么是Excel索引?
Excel索引指的是在数据表中,通过一个或多个参数,来确定某个位置的数据。例如,在一个包含多列数据的表格中,如果我们想找到第3行第2列的数据,就可以使用索引功能来实现这个目标。索引是Excel中用于定位数据位置的核心工具之一,它使用户能够高效地进行数据查找和操作。
索引的实现方式多种多样,常见的有使用“INDEX”函数、结合“MATCH”函数使用、“ROW”函数、“COLUMN”函数等。这些函数在Excel中可以组合使用,以实现更复杂的查询和操作。
二、索引的基本原理
索引的核心在于“位置”和“引用”。Excel中的索引功能本质上是一种通过参数定位数据位置的机制。在Excel中,索引可以用于以下几种情况:
1. 定位数据:在数据表中,用户可以通过索引功能快速找到特定行或列的数据。
2. 数据引用:通过索引,用户可以从一个数据范围中引用特定位置的数据,比如引用第3行第2列的数据。
3. 数据操作:索引可以与其它函数结合使用,实现数据的筛选、排序、计算等操作。
索引的实现方式通常基于“行号”和“列号”,用户可以通过输入行号和列号来定位数据的位置。例如,使用“INDEX(范围, 行号, 列号)”函数,可以引用特定位置的数据。
三、索引的基本使用方法
在Excel中,索引功能主要通过“INDEX”函数来实现。其基本语法如下:
INDEX(范围, 行号, 列号)
- 范围:要引用的数据区域,例如A1:C10。
- 行号:要引用的行号,例如3。
- 列号:要引用的列号,例如2。
示例:
假设我们有一个数据表,数据范围是A1:C10,内容如下:
| A | B | C |
|--|--|--|
| 1 | 10 | 100 |
| 2 | 20 | 200 |
| 3 | 30 | 300 |
如果我们想查找第3行第2列的数据,可以使用以下公式:
=INDEX(A1:C10, 3, 2)
这个公式将返回“30”。
四、索引的高级应用
索引不仅仅可以用于简单定位数据,还可以通过与其他函数的结合,实现更复杂的操作。以下是几种常见的高级应用:
1. 结合“MATCH”函数使用
“MATCH”函数用于查找某个值在数据范围中的位置,而“INDEX”函数则用于引用该位置的数据。它们的组合可以实现数据查找和引用。
示例:
假设我们有一个数据表,其中A列是产品名称,B列是价格,我们想查找“笔记本电脑”的价格,可以使用以下公式:
=INDEX(B1:B10, MATCH("笔记本电脑", A1:A10, 0))
这个公式首先使用“MATCH”函数查找“笔记本电脑”在A列中的位置,然后使用“INDEX”函数引用该位置对应的价格。
2. 结合“ROW”函数使用
“ROW”函数用于返回当前单元格的行号,可以用于动态定位数据位置。
示例:
如果我们要引用当前工作表中第3行的数据,可以使用以下公式:
=INDEX(A1:A10, ROW(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1。
3. 结合“COLUMN”函数使用
“COLUMN”函数用于返回当前单元格的列号,可以用于动态定位数据位置。
示例:
如果我们要引用当前工作表中第2列的数据,可以使用以下公式:
=INDEX(A1:C10, ROW(1), COLUMN(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1,COLUMN(1)返回的是1。
五、索引的常见误区与注意事项
在使用索引功能时,用户可能会遇到一些常见的误区和问题,以下是几个需要注意的事项:
1. 索引的参数必须是整数
在Excel中,索引函数的参数必须是整数,不能是文本或小数。例如,使用“INDEX(A1:C10, 3.5)”是无效的。
2. 索引不能用于非连续数据
索引功能只能用于连续的数据范围,不能用于非连续的单元格。例如,如果数据范围是A1:A10和C1:C10,不能直接使用“INDEX”函数引用其中的数据。
3. 索引的数值范围需要合理
索引的行号和列号必须在数据范围的合法范围内。如果超出范围,Excel会返回错误值。
4. 索引的使用需要结合其他函数
索引功能通常需要与其他函数配合使用,才能实现更复杂的操作。例如,使用“INDEX”和“MATCH”组合可以实现数据查找。
六、索引的实际应用案例
索引在实际工作中有着广泛的应用,以下是几个实际案例:
案例1:数据表查询
假设我们有一个销售数据表,包含产品名称、销售数量和销售额。我们想查找某个产品的销售额,可以使用以下公式:
=INDEX(B2:B10, MATCH(C2, A2:A10, 0))
这个公式会找到“笔记本电脑”在A列中的位置,然后返回对应的产品销售额。
案例2:动态数据引用
在Excel中,我们经常需要引用当前工作表中的特定数据。例如,如果我们有一个数据表,数据范围是A1:C10,我们想引用第1行第3列的数据,可以使用:
=INDEX(A1:C10, 1, 3)
这个公式将返回A1:C10中的第1行第3列的数据。
案例3:动态行号引用
如果我们想引用当前工作表中第3行的数据,可以使用以下公式:
=INDEX(A1:A10, ROW(1))
这个公式会返回A1单元格的数据,因为ROW(1)返回的是1。
七、索引的未来发展与趋势
随着Excel的不断升级,索引功能也在不断完善和优化。未来,Excel可能会引入更多智能化的索引功能,比如基于数据类型、条件筛选、动态范围等的索引,使得用户可以更方便地进行数据操作。
此外,随着人工智能和机器学习技术的发展,Excel可能逐步引入智能索引功能,帮助用户更快地找到所需数据。
八、总结
Excel索引是一种非常实用的功能,它帮助用户快速定位和引用数据,并且可以通过与其他函数的结合实现更复杂的操作。在实际工作中,索引功能可以极大地提高数据处理的效率和准确性。用户在使用索引时,需要注意参数的正确性、范围的合法性和与其他函数的配合使用。
掌握Excel索引功能,不仅能够提升工作效率,还能帮助用户更好地理解和处理数据。希望本文能够为用户提供有价值的参考和帮助。
推荐文章
Excel 函数:计数函数详解与实用技巧在Excel中,计数函数是数据处理和分析中非常基础且重要的工具。通过这些函数,用户可以轻松地统计数据集中满足特定条件的单元格数量,从而进行数据汇总、趋势分析和决策支持。Excel提供了多种计数函
2025-12-27 10:20:33
193人看过
为什么Excel超级大?在当今数据驱动的时代,Excel已经不仅仅是一个办公软件,它已成为企业、个人和开发者不可或缺的工具。Excel之所以能够在众多办公软件中脱颖而出,是因为它具备强大的功能、灵活的操作方式以及广泛的适用场景。本文将
2025-12-27 10:20:32
307人看过
Excel 为什么滚动?——深度解析 Excel 的滚动机制与使用价值Excel 是一款广泛应用于数据处理、表格管理、财务分析等领域的办公软件。在使用 Excel 时,我们经常能看到表格数据滚动的场景,例如在查看数据表的某一列或某一行
2025-12-27 10:20:31
89人看过
Excel 冻结窗口代表什么:深度解析与实用技巧Excel 是一款广泛使用的电子表格软件,它在数据处理、分析、报表制作等方面具有极高的实用性。其中,冻结窗口(Freeze Panes)是一项非常实用的功能,它能够帮助用户在表格
2025-12-27 10:20:28
347人看过
.webp)
.webp)

